A Modeling Layer for Constraint-Programming Libraries

Published Online:https://doi.org/10.1287/ijoc.1040.0076

References

  • Barth P., Bockmayr A. Modelling mixed-integer optimisation problems in constraint logic programming. (1995) . Technical report MPI-I-95-2-011, Max-Planck-Institut für Informatik, Saarbrücken, GermanyGoogle Scholar
  • Bisschop J., Meeraus A. On the development of a general algebraic modeling system in a strategic planning environment. Math. Programming Stud. (1982) 20:1–29CrossrefGoogle Scholar
  • Cheng B. M. W., Lee J. H. M., Leung H. F., Leung Y. W. Speeding up constraint propagation by redundant modeling. Proc. Second Internat. Conf. Principles Practice Constraint Programming (CP'96) (1996) (Springer-Verlag, Cambridge, MA) 104–118CrossrefGoogle Scholar
  • Colmerauer A. An introduction to Prolog III. Commun. ACM (1990) 33(7):69–90CrossrefGoogle Scholar
  • Colmerauer A. Spécification de Prolog IV. (1996) . Technical report, Laboratoire d'informatique de Marseille, Marseille, FranceGoogle Scholar
  • de Givry S., Jeannin L. ToOLS: A library for partial and hybrid search methods. 5th Internat. Workshop Integration AI OR Techniques Constraint Program Combin. Optim. Problems (CPAIOR'03) (2003) Montreal, CanadaGoogle Scholar
  • Dincbas M., Van Hentenryck P., Simonis H., Aggoun A., Graf T., Berthier F. The constraint logic programming language CHIP. Proc. Internat. Conf. Fifth Generation Comput. Systems (1988) Tokyo, JapanGoogle Scholar
  • El Sakkout H., Wallace M. Probe backtrack search for minimal perturbation in dynamic scheduling. Constraints (2000) 5:359–388CrossrefGoogle Scholar
  • Fourer R., Gay D., Kernighan B. W.AMPL: A Modeling Language for Mathematical Programming (1993) (The Scientific Press, San Francisco, CA) Google Scholar
  • Gusfield D., Irving R. W.The Stable Marriage Problem: Structure and Algorithms (1989) (The MIT Press, Cambridge, MA) Google Scholar
  • Ilog SA Ilog Solver 4.4, Reference Manual. (1998) . Ilog SA Gentilly, FranceGoogle Scholar
  • Laburthe F., Caseau Y. SALSA: A language for search algorithms. Fourth Internat. Conf. Principles Practice Constraint Programming (CP'98) (1998) Pisa, Italy:310–324CrossrefGoogle Scholar
  • McAloon K., Tretkoff C., Wetzel G. Sport league scheduling. Proc. Third Ilog Internat. Users Meeting (1997) Paris, FranceGoogle Scholar
  • Michel L., Van Hentenryck P. Localizer++: An open library for local search. (2001) . Technical report CS-01-02, Department of Computer Science, Brown University, Providence, RIGoogle Scholar
  • Puget J.-F., Leconte M. Beyond the glass box: Constraints as objects. Proc. Internat. Sympos. Logic Programming (ILPS-95) (1995) Portland, OR:513–527Google Scholar
  • Régin J.-C. Sport league scheduling. INFORMS National Meeting (1998) (Montreal, Canada)Google Scholar
  • Schulte C. Programming constraint inference engines. Proc. Third Internat. Conf. Principles Practice Constraint Programming (1997) 1330Linz, Austria(Springer-Verlag, Heidelberg, Germany) 519–533CrossrefGoogle Scholar
  • Smolka G., van Leeuwen Jan. The Oz programming model. Computer Science Today (1995) (Springer-Verlag, Berlin, Germany) 324–343LNCS, No. 1000CrossrefGoogle Scholar
  • Van Hentenryck P.The OPL Optimization Programming Language (1999) (MIT Press, Cambridge, MA) Google Scholar
  • Van Hentenryck P., Deville Y. The cardinality operator: A new logical connective and its application to constraint logic programming. Eighth Internat. Conf. Logic Programming (ICLP-91) (1991) Paris, France:745–759Google Scholar
  • Van Hentenryck P., Michel L., Paulin F., Puget J. F.Modeling Languages For Mathematical Optimization (2003) (Kluwer Academic Publishers, Boston, MA) . Ch. 9. The OPL Studio Modeling SystemGoogle Scholar
  • Van Hentenryck P., Michel L., Laborie P., Nuijten W., Rogerie J. Combinatorial optimization in OPL studio. Proc. Ninth Portuguese Conf. Artificial Intelligence Internat. Conf. (EPIA'99) (1999a) Evora, Portugal:1–15CrossrefGoogle Scholar
  • Van Hentenryck P., Michel L., Perron L., Regin J. C. Constraint programming in OPL. Proc. Internat. Conf. Principles Practice Declarative Programming (PPDP'99) (1999b) Paris, France:98–116CrossrefGoogle Scholar
  • Van Hentenryck P., Perron L., Puget J.-F. Search and strategies in OPL. ACM Trans. Comput. Logic (2000) 1:1–36CrossrefGoogle Scholar
INFORMS site uses cookies to store information on your computer. Some are essential to make our site work; Others help us improve the user experience. By using this site, you consent to the placement of these cookies. Please read our Privacy Statement to learn more.